Hello Everyone,

I recently viewed BRS’s video regarding keeping the two purple tangs in their 160 and what things to take into consideration. I wanted to ask if anyone has had success with keeping 3 purple tangs? I have a 120 gallon tank that I am restarting and wanted to introduce 3 juvenile purple tangs once it is up and running. Is this possible? Appreciate any feedback!
 
I have a Purple Tang and a Blue Eyed Kole Tang (a/k/a Two Spot) together in a 150, without any problems. The main difference would be that your 120 is probably 18 inches wide rather than 24”. Also— full disclosure— my full grown Purple has always been a ‘Sissy’, since I got him at 2”. (Not the usual aggressive Purple most people talk about.)

My tank is 48x24x24
 
Oh, only 48” long? I would skip the Purple; stick with 1 Kole Tang or something similar. You have to think of your rock work, too; it with play a role in how your fish interact, given those tank dimensions.
 
I’ve got three purples, gem, sailfin, yellow and hippo . The largest purple is a jerk but the sailfin(#1) and hippo (#2) keep it in check
